Latest Patents

Hoffmann holds a patent for a Satellite Amplifier System. This system is designed to amplify and distribute multiple input transmission channels to various outputs, each corresponding to a specific beam. The system features a switch with multiple inputs for routing transmission channels, a Butler matrix for signal processing, and an inverse Butler matrix connected by amplifiers. Additionally, it includes output demultiplexers that separate transmission channels by frequency, ensuring optimal performance in satellite communications.
